My building has five storeys and on the fifth floor we have a fixed ladder made of steel 4m high which leads to the elevator engine room and a flat roof for the whole building.
The ladder serves the elevator technicians and general maintenance of sun water heaters such as water tanks and collectors, and of course we have several satellite dishes on the roof.
The ladder is robust and can handle the weights of persons and heavy loads. It has a total of 9 steps (rods) with 35cm spacing and 35cm wide inside.
But it is very uncomfortable to climb, mainly because of the angle, the steps are just a rod and it is narrow only 40cm wide total. Some photos are attached.
Anyway, last time I climbed it, I twisted my back during the descent and since then I don't dare to climb it again.
I am thinking of replacing it with something modern and comfortable, and have contacted a local ladder manufacturer (also importer of ladders made in Germany) to suggest a better solution.
If we go for the same type of ladder, then I would want a more comfortable step design, wider ladder perhaps 60cm instead of 40cm, make the spacing shorter like 25-30cm instead of 35cm. Unfortunately there isn't much we can do with the angle which is about 15 degrees.
Perhaps a better solution would be spiral stairs but it must be very expensive to design and install.
I would appreciate your feedback and suggestions. Thanks

It is not just a maintenance ladder. Last year a building nearby had a fire on the seventh floor and many tenants ran to the roof and were rescued by fire fighters. Elderly tenants in our building can't climb our existing ladder, and if the elevator stops for any reason, I or any other tenant can run to the engine room and move the elevator up and down slightly with a handle until it is level on one of the floors.
For emergencies, we really need a better means to go up to the roof.
The 35cm spacing between steps is very large compared to today's standard. It should be around 25-30cm.
I twisted my back because I am not young anymore and any unusual twisting of the body while coming down, put a pressure on my spine.
I am considering spiral stairs, but it seems the minimum floor diameter required by several manufacturers from the US is 42" (~107cm). We have only 35" D (90cm). The advantage is that the final step can face straight to the left, where the roof is.
